    If you had a subscribed older radio and have just upgraded to a new one, all you have to do is contact sirius, or Xm if that's the service you have, and tell them you have purchased a new radio and need to transfer your subscription from the old one to the new one. They sill then ask you for the SID number that can be located on the back of the new unit you bought and they will be able to help you from there.
